1. Wales Millennium Centre

1.1. Architecture

Among the city theatres, this has the finest venue in Cardiff and its world-class facilities.

Its architecture, influenced by Welsh culture, is a city landmark. Therefore, visiting this location with friends and family is a must.

Since its establishment, its main space, called the Donald Gordon Theatre, is not only the main stage of the theatre but also one of the largest in the world. Its excellent sound systems provide an immersive experience to the audience.

Furthermore, the theatre has a majestic appearance. The seats span from top to bottom of the hall. Besides offering a clear view of the artists, the setting is also a true marvel to the eyes.

1.2. Events and Shows

This multi-cultural theatre in Cardiff offers various performances. Its operas, ballets, musicals, and dramas reflect Welsh traditions. The venue also hosts galleries, musicals, and operas. The experience provided here is something you will not want to miss out on.

It also invites renowned celebrities to perform on stage. Some of the popular shows hosted by this theatre include a virtual reality program. There is also a musical adaptation of Disney’s Winnie the Pooh and a stand-up comedy by James Acaster.

1.3. Community Outreach and Programs

The theatre has a group of actors, creative directors, budding artists, and a supportive staff. They work together to craft events that are critically acclaimed.

It is due to their hard work that the theatre spins out world-class productions and, consequently, attracts 1.6 million visitors annually.

Furthermore, the theatre also has members and partners around the globe. In addition to providing financial aid, they directly engage with its projects.

2. New Theatre Cardiff

2.1. Architecture

Founded in 1906, this iconic theatre in Cardiff is rich in history and charm. The theatre style reflects Edwardian architecture, making it one of the most famous theatres in Wales.

The interior is a sight to behold with its classic red-and-gold architecture. Furthermore, the imposing halls with great sound systems will give you an unforgettable experience.

2.2. Events and Shows

Besides offering a fun experience for the younger audience, it tells poignant narratives for adults. The theatre takes you on a nostalgic journey with its world-class circus acts. It also offers live shows by some of your favourite bands.

Furthermore, it conducts adventurous events such as the Jurassic Earth. This recreation of Jurassic World is bound to make you giddy like a child!

Whether you are into intense dramas, amusing stand-ups, or charming musicals, it is a place you will not regret visiting.

3. Sherman Theatre

Located in the heart of Cardiff, this theatre is a sanctuary for all those people who love to explore theatres. Here, you can enjoy shows that address human boundaries and other contemporary issues.

3.1. Architecture

Built as a twin auditorium, the theatre represents a minimalist approach and unique exterior design.

Also, a noteworthy feature is its large glass walls. These not only bring natural sunlight but also offer a sense of transparency to the visitors.

3.2. Events and Shows

This venue hosts hundreds of events yearly, such as comedy and live performances. With their intense acts, the artists leave the audience with a strong message.

Its dynamic performances challenge the modern mind. Thereby encouraging discussions about mental health and other social issues.

Additionally, the theatre also houses a studio and an art gallery. There is also a cinema for a more engaging experience.

As a result of its experimental plays and thought-provoking dramas, it is a vital force behind shaping Cardiff’s theatres.

3.3. Sherman Community Groups

Sherman Theatre has a group of renowned artists and passionate young minds that work as a community.

Its only mission is to tell the stories of its people, culture, and tradition.

They put together quality productions and also facilitate behind-the-scenes touring programs. Thus, the audience can witness the hard work and dedication needed for a successful show.

This theatre in Cardiff also conducts various activities in colleges and schools. The students interact with each other and are undoubtedly inspired to contribute to the theatre’s mission.

4. Royal Welsh College of Music and Drama

This theatre is primarily an institution of education. It showcases the artistic capabilities of its students and faculties with its shows.

4.1. Architecture

The building has distinct symmetrical patterns and angular walls. These divide the space into small halls for events to take place simultaneously.

Furthermore, the seats are arranged in vertical stacks around the building. As a result, it provides the audience with a clear view from all angles.

Source: Official Website of Royal Welsh College of Music and Drama

The college is a testament to the city’s artistic temper.

Its nurturing environment attracts talents from across the world. Furthermore, its excellent cast facilitates the best training experiences.

4.2. Events and Shows

The theatre is considered Wales’ national conservatoire as it hosts hundreds of performances every year. These include orchestra, drama, concerts, and live music.

The Royal Welsh College is a place that creates future stars and offers the audience a chance to witness their talent firsthand.
